One lesson of this week’s oil-price crash is that markets aren’t performing very effectively throughout the coronavirus disaster. 

On Monday, the benchmark U.S. oil futures contract for Could supply tumbled to an unprecedented destructive value, largely as a result of storage tanks are stuffed with a product few can use. How that stunned skilled oil merchants may appear a thriller, since vitality corporations and Texas state officers had been warning for weeks that storage capability was working out.

Commentators rapidly identified that the worth anomaly was restricted to the Could contract; the futures contract for June supply, in any case, was nonetheless buying and selling above $20 a barrel – a greater reflection of oil’s true value. “Technical components clarify a number of the decline,” the New York Occasions wrote. “Oil watchers do not take into account it essentially the most correct reflection of value motion,” the Wall Road Journal wrote. 

Then on Tuesday, that narrative proved fanciful when the June contract tumbled greater than 43 p.c to a 21-year low of $11.57 a barrel. The Could contract settled at $10.01. 

The one information was the worth discovery: It seems oil is price quite a bit much less now than it was initially of the week, or in early April when it traded nearer to $30 a barrel.

The takeaway for bitcoin merchants is that there may be plenty of components in cryptocurrency markets which are identified, however probably not mirrored within the value.

These might embrace the deflationary impression of the coronavirus-induced international recessionand the potential inflationary forces of the Federal Reserve’s trillions of {dollars} of emergency cash injections. One other may be the upcoming miner-rewards halving, resulting from happen subsequent month on the bitcoin blockchain. 

“The markets are simply merely reflecting at this level what is going on on in the true economic system, which clearly is plenty of volatility,” Commodity Futures Buying and selling Fee Chair Heath Tarbert instructed CNBC on Tuesday, in an interview in regards to the oil market. 

The truth unfolds slowly, and the volatility occurs hastily.

This would possibly assist clarify why bitcoin has been caught for all of April in a spread between $6,400 and $7,400, even within the midst of what seems to be the world’s largest well being emergency and financial disaster to date this century.

“Bitcoin barely flinched as destructive oil costs despatched shockwaves by way of conventional markets and in relative phrases has held up very nicely,” the Israeli buying and selling platform eToro famous Tuesday in an e mail to shoppers.

Was that the precise response for the bitcoin market? 

There’s a lot that merchants do not know in regards to the future course of the pandemic, and of its ramifications for enterprise, society and tradition. Nevertheless it’s not even clear if markets have correctly priced in what merchants already know. 

Bitcoin is commonly touted by merchants as a hedge in opposition to inflation, and lots of cryptocurrency buyers assume that the Fed’s cash injections will ultimately spur quicker value rises. However Deutsche Financial institution has predicted in current experiences that the U.S. unemployment fee will rise to a post-World Conflict II document of 17 p.c, placing downward strain on wages. That is deflationary. 

For bitcoin merchants, squaring the countervailing forces provides to the frustration of attempting to divine what kind of hypothesis the bitcoin market is already reflecting. Is Could’s halving priced into the market, provided that it was placed on the schedule 11 years in the past when the bitcoin blockchain was launched? That debate’s been raging for months. 

The oil-price collapse this week exhibits how unhealthy markets could be at reflecting what’s already identified till there is a laborious actuality examine on provide and demand.  

Which may imply bitcoin merchants will not know the worth impression of the cryptocurrency’s potential adoption as an inflation hedge till extra mainstream buyers really begin shopping for. 

And it would imply that the market will not see the complete impression of Could’s halving till it comes – and possibly goes.
